Bluestone Leasing has launched a partnership
programme to support its vendors achieve greater sales, improve
profitability and deliver business growth.

The initiative – called the Attain programme –
includes sales training, bespoke marketing tools, a loyalty
programme and tailored account management.

Attain will only be open to certified
suppliers who wish to fully integrate leasing into their sales
process and fully partner with Bluestone Leasing.

Steve Russell, sales director of Bluestone
Leasing, said: “Much of the business we do is through vendors who
may have little or no experience of leasing. We have developed
Attain to address this issue and allow all of our partners to make
the most of our expertise and experience.”

Bluestone Leasing chief executive Phillip
Bennett said: “As Bluestone Leasing continues to grow we must be
strategically focused on supporting our vendors to ensure that we
can help them deliver the best possible service.”

Trading since 1996, Bluestone Leasing
specialises in technology focused asset funding including IT,
telecommunications, audiovisual and furniture.
